Transaction 2e8cea32c59c75096267ddb7e06dfd0104623bc3251fa469a58c0d5b7d74a386
1 Input
1 Output
-
2e8cea32c59c75096267ddb7e06dfd0104623bc3251fa469a58c0d5b7d74a386:0
- value
- 930860
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 137a8432090154ec70b6a831dac5fe19e505822b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12mzcEVkdmMjx8A1njdZoXsThpyFfn5zHC